‘Doctor Who’ Season 13 (‘Flux’) Soundtrack Album Announced
Posted: September 16, 2022 by filmmusicreporter in TV Music AlbumsTags: BBC, BBC America, Doctor Who, score, Segun Akinola, Soundtrack
Silva Screen Records has announced a new soundtrack album for BBC series Doctor Who. The album features selections of the original music from the show’s thirteenth season (entitled Flux) composed by Segun Akinola (The Last Tree, Stephen, 9/11: Inside the President’s War Room).
